Lead and support the planning, coordination, and monitoring of supply chain activities to ensure efficient product flow from suppliers to customers.
Responsibilities
- Safety
- Uphold company HSE policy by conducting internal safety audit and other related safety activities.
- Production Planning & Scheduling
- Develop, manage, and optimize the Master Production Schedule (MPS) based on customer demand, capacity, and material availability.
- Ensure production plans align with company goals for efficiency, quality, and DIFOT.
- Adjust schedules proactively in response to changes in demand, machine breakdowns, or material constraints.
- Supply Management
- Perform capacity planning to balance workload across lines facility MCL, CPL, SLT).
- Identify production bottlenecks and collaborate with operations/manufacture to implement improvements.
- Material Planning & Inventory Management.
- Oversee MRP processes and ensure material requirements are accurately planned and available for production.
- Maintain optimal inventory levels by managing safety stock, lead times, and reorder points.
- Identify risks of stock shortages or overstock situations.
- Support inventory optimization to reduce holding costs.
- Supplier & Procurement Coordination
- Work closely with procurement to ensure timely sourcing of raw materials, components, and consumables.
- Review supplier performance (OTIF, quality, lead time) and manage escalations when necessary.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ration
- Collaborate with manufacturing, procurement, quality, engineering, and logistics to maintain smooth operations.
- Lead daily production planning meetings to align priorities and resolve issues.
- Serve as the main point of contact for customer service regarding production status and delivery commitments.
- Data Analysis & Reporting
- Track and report key KPIs: production adherence, inventory accuracy and DIFOT.
- Analyze production and material data to identify trends, risks, and improvement opportunities.
- Prepare weekly/monthly planning dashboards for management review.
- Continuous Improvement
- Implement process improvements for planning, scheduling, and material flow.
- Support digitalization/ERP enhancements for better visibility and efficiency.
- Lead initiatives such as lean manufacturing, waste reduction, and cycle time optimization.
- Assist Supply Chain Planning Manager by developing and directing the strategy and action plan in-order to achieve business objectives
